阴阳快递员txt下载:EXCEL计算年龄相关公式

来源:百度文库 编辑:中财网 时间:2024/04/28 14:56:36
一、公式性别:IF(LEN(C2)=15,IF(MOD(MID(C2,15,1),2)=1,"男","女"),IF(MOD(MID(C2,17,1),2)=1,"男","女"))年龄:1、DATEDIF(TEXT(MID(G4,7,6+(LEN(G4)=18)*2),"#-00-00"),TODAY(),"y")        2、DATEDIF(C8,TODAY(),"y")出生日期:1、IF(G4<>"",TEXT((LEN(G4)=15)*19&MID(G4,7,6+(LEN(G4)=18)*2),"#-00-00")+0,)             2、IF(LEN(A4)=18,DATE(MID(A4,7,4),MID(A4,11,2),MID(A4,13,2)),DATE(19*100+MID(A4,7,2),MID(A4,9,2),MID(A4,11,2))) 二、你可以根据一个人的生日计算他的年龄                
    这个计算要使用 DATEDIF() 函数.                
    DATEDIF()不能在 Excel 5, 7 or 97中使用, 但是在excel 2000中可以.                
    (不要奇怪微软公司没有告诉我们!)                

    出生日期 :    1-Jan-60            

    生活的年:    48     =DATEDIF(C8,TODAY(),"y")        
    和月:    11     =DATEDIF(C8,TODAY(),"ym")        
    和日 :    3     =DATEDIF(C8,TODAY(),"md")        

    你可以把它们连接起来使用                
    年龄是 48 年, 11 月和 3 天                
     ="年龄是 "&DATEDIF(C8,TODAY(),"y")&" 年, "&DATEDIF(C8,TODAY(),"ym")&" 月和 "&DATEDIF(C8,TODAY(),"md")&" 天"                

    计算年龄的另一个方法                
    这种方法是将月折算成小数                
    如果年龄是20.5岁, 这个0.5岁代表 6个 月.                

    出生日期:    1-Jan-60            

    年龄是:    48.93     =(TODAY()-C23)/365.25